你查询的IP:[124.220.120.52]  地理位置:中国–上海–上海

最新查询119.20.68.223 116.252.215.29 202.93.180.198 118.178.1.241 118.84.51.61 118.24.100.210 120.24.250.254 218.108.210.245 118.239.193.231 124.220.120.52 118.248.147.221 119.128.236.86 60.160.254.129 121.58.255.149 202.38.156.213 203.175.128.145 203.83.56.177 119.59.128.132 120.136.128.170 203.91.32.181 218.240.36.61 121.89.204.168 117.121.148.59 202.63.248.101 121.58.144.243 59.108.39.98 203.171.224.108 116.198.22.117 122.192.147.63 121.59.167.79 221.198.173.242